鱼C论坛

 找回密码
 立即注册
查看: 2150|回复: 0

[技术交流] python学习笔记之变量和字符串

[复制链接]
发表于 2017-6-30 17:03:21 | 显示全部楼层 |阅读模式

马上注册,结交更多好友,享用更多功能^_^

您需要 登录 才可以下载或查看,没有账号?立即注册

x
本帖最后由 zh_ 于 2017-6-30 17:17 编辑


变量和字符串
  • 不需要先定义“变量”,直接使用即可,但是在使用变量前要先对其赋值
  • 并不存在“变量”,而更像是一个名字
  • “变量”区分大小写
  • 给“变量”赋值字符串要在字符串两侧加上引号,可以是单引号,也可以是双引号
  • 字符串中含有单引号或者双引号的打印方式
    • 使用“\”对引号进行转义
    • 如果字符串中含有单引号,则可以使用双引号将字符串括起来。如果字符串含有双引号,则可以用单引号将字符串括起来
  • 反斜杠可以对反斜杠自身进行转义
  • 可以使用原始字符串
    1. str = r'c:\user’
    复制代码

    即在字符串前边加上英文字母r即可
    • 原始字符串的不能以单个‘\’结尾,如下会报错。
      1. str = r'c\now\’
      复制代码
      双斜杠结尾不会报错
      1. str = r'c\now\\'
      复制代码
      结尾两个反斜杠中没有被转义。可以使用如下方法在结尾加反斜杠
      1. str = r'c\now''\\'
      复制代码

  • 三重引号字符串如果打印多行字符可以使用三重引号字符串
  1.     str = """abc \n 123 \n 456"""
复制代码
     打印结果
  1.      abc \n 123 \n 456
复制代码
  • print打印完默认换行,使用(end = " ")参数就可以使用空格代替换行
    1. print("abc",end=" ")
    复制代码

评分

参与人数 1鱼币 +2 收起 理由
康小泡 + 2

查看全部评分

本帖被以下淘专辑推荐:

想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

小黑屋|手机版|Archiver|鱼C工作室 ( 粤ICP备18085999号-1 | 粤公网安备 44051102000585号)

GMT+8, 2024-4-29 00:31

Powered by Discuz! X3.4

© 2001-2023 Discuz! Team.

快速回复 返回顶部 返回列表